About Ryan O’Hayre

Ryan O’Hayre is a scholar working on Renewable Energy, Sustainability and the Environment, Materials Chemistry, Catalysis,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ials, having authored 210 papers that have together received 14.8k indexed citations. Recurring topics across this work include Advancements in Solid Oxide Fuel Cells (99 papers), Fuel Cells and Related Materials (90 papers), Electrocatalysts for Energy Conversion (65 papers), Electronic and Structural Properties of Oxides (57 papers), Advanced battery technologies research (25 papers), Magnetic and transport properties of perovskites and related materials (23 papers), Chemical Looping and Thermochemical Processes (17 papers) and Catalytic Processes in Materials Science (14 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(5.0k citations), Catalysis (1.6k citations), Materials Chemistry (10.0k citations), Electronic, Optical and Magnetic Materials (2.9k citations) and Electrical and Electronic Engineering (8.3k citations). Ryan O’Hayre has collaborated with scholars based in United States, China and Australia. Frequent co-authors include Chuancheng Duan, Jianhua Tong, Svitlana Pylypenko, Zongping Shao, Fritz B. Prinz, Neal P. Sullivan, Yingke Zhou, Michael Sanders, Sandrine Ricote and David S. Ginley. Their work appears in journals such as Journal of Power Sources, Journal of The Electrochemical Society, Solid State Ionics, Energy & Environmental Science and Journal of Materials Chemistry A.
